Clementine Kennicutt is a proper Bostonian lady until she literally bumps into Gus McQueen and elopes with him to Montana. Hannah Yorke is the town prostitute who becomes a prosperous landowner, though she is forever marked by her past. And Erlan Woo is a young Chinese picture bride whose heart remains in China. These three seemingly mismatched characters become fast friends.

All her life,Clementine Kennicutt has been filled with restless longing.A ladylike New Englander,she yearns to escape the chafing authoritarian rule of her pious,unforgiving father.Clementine has never metanyone remotely like Gus McQueen.So when the cowboy with the laughing eyes and big,urgent dreams presses her to elope with him to his Montana ranch,she is ready.But nothing had prepared her for the harsh realities of frontier life or for the unpredictable hankering of the heart-least of all for the fact that almost from the first moment she set eyes on Zach,Gus's dashing ne'er-do-well brother,she knows he's the one she was destined to love.Possessed of a rare spirit and courage,Clementine determines not to let the frontier defeat her as she strives for happiness and fulfillment within her fragile marriage.

If you've ever had a hankerin' to go to Montana,this is the romance novel for you. Full of time period details and the descriptions of the land, the weather, the aura of the whole experience of living in Montana left me aching for my next road trip.
